What is FE 510 steel?

Fe-510 steel is a structural billet steel for structural applications. Fe-510 is a material grade and designation defined in ISO 630 standard. ISO 630 is an international material standard for billet steel for general structural usage. Fe-430 steel can be compared with this type of steel.

What is Grade 43A steel?

BS 4360 Grade 43A was withdrawn and superceded by BS EN 10025 S275. This grade is a popular low carbon steeel grade and is suitable for a large number of engineering applications.

What is CR4 steel?

CR4 stands for Cold reduced steel sheets. Making steel sheets and plates using this method results in a product with a smoother surface and a fine finish. This product Is used for a multitude of purposes including fuel tanks, tool boxes, drip pans, trailer siding, etc.

What is A1018 steel?

The A1018 specification is the Standard specification for heavy gauge Hot-Rolled Sheet and Strip Carbon(CS), Structural(SS)), High-Strength Low-Alloy(HSLAS), High-Strength Low-Alloy with Improved Formability(HSLAS-F), and Ultra-High Strength(UHSS) steels in thicknesses over 0.230″(6 mm) up to and including 1.0″.

What does fe410 mean?

Steel is designated in India as Fe 310, Fe 410 WA, Fe 540 B, Fe 590, etc. ,where Fe stands for the steel and the number after Fe is the characteristic ultimate tensile stress in megapascals. The letter A, B, or C indicates the grade of steel. The letter W denotes that the steel is weldable.

What grade is CR4 steel?

What are CR4 Steels? CR4 steels are deep drawing quality Aluminum Killed (non-aging) mild steel revealed in ISO 3574 and are graded correspondent to SPCF steels in JIS G3141 standard.
